Web1 mrt. 2024 · This case shows that intravenous dimenhydrinate can trigger the development of acute urinary retention in patients under long-term treatment with sertraline, which is why it should be given with caution in this group of patients. The antihistamine dimenhydrinate as the trigger of acute urinary retention has not been reported. Web28 nov. 2024 · Urinary retention is a relatively common urological problem encountered in both inpatient and outpatient situations. It should be suspected in any patient with lower abdominal discomfort and any degree of urinary difficulty.
